The Vetting & Onboarding Manager is responsible for the delivery, governance and continuous improvement of all pre-employment screening, background checking, onboarding and related compliance processes across the organisation.
The role ensures that all employees, contractors and consultants meet internal, legal, regulatory and client-specific vetting requirements before commencing work. The role also owns the onboarding experience, ensuring a compliant, efficient and professional journey from offer acceptance through to successful integration into the business.
The postholder will manage external screening suppliers, lead a specialist team and work closely with Recruitment, HR, Legal, Operations, IT, Security and client-facing teams to ensure robust compliance controls are maintained.
